- [ ] **Stale-branch bot (Tidyvane) pre-release check.** Confirm the protected-branch list matches the current repo config; the bot deletes anything unmerged past 90 days that isn't listed. Dry-run mode must be ON for the first cycle after any release. Verify the audit log target exists, or deletions go unrecorded. If Tidyvane misfires, restore from reflog mirrors within 30 days. Sign off only after the dry-run report is clean. Attach the build token printed below to the release notes.

pipeline stamp: htk6_35e0c9

Ticket: Config drift on the Haldane garage occupancy feed. The Ostermill node is publishing counts every 5s while the other three garages publish every 15s, which skews the aggregation window downstream in Lotgrid. Someone hot-patched the interval during the holiday surge and never reverted. Please review the diff and restore parity across all nodes. The intended baseline configuration is as follows.

settings of kahip-hafop:
ralix:
  log_level: warn
  metrics_host: metrics.ralix.zemvarsys.internal
  pin: 8273
  pool_size: 8

Hi Priya — quick handover before I'm off. The wet lab on level 3 is shared with the Meridian Optics crew, so book benches via the wall calendar, not the app (theirs doesn't sync). Fume hood 2 is theirs on Tuesdays. New starters should shadow someone for the first week before running anything solo. The side door sticks, so push hard. The keypad code for the lab entrance is below.

staff pass of kawip-hawef = bdg-QLP-2

Ticket QM-812: Log compaction stalls on QueueForge brokers

Hey new folks, welcome to your first fun one. Compaction on the orders topic keeps stalling whenever a segment contains tombstones older than the retention window. The compactor thread just sits there politely doing nothing, and disk usage creeps up until Marnie's dashboard goes red. Repro is easy on the staging cluster — run the seed script, wait ten minutes. The stall first appeared in the build referenced below.

build token for kagaf-hahof: htk14_9d3d4d26d7d8de